What is call for proposals?
A call for proposals is a formal request for submissions of project ideas or solutions to a particular problem from qualified individuals or organizations.
Who is required to file call for proposals?
Typically, government agencies, non-profit organizations, or funding bodies are required to file a call for proposals to invite potential applicants to submit their projects.
How to fill out call for proposals?
To fill out a call for proposals, applicants need to carefully read the guidelines, requirements, and submission instructions provided by the issuing organization. They then need to prepare a detailed proposal that addresses all the key points outlined in the call.
What is the purpose of call for proposals?
The purpose of a call for proposals is to solicit innovative project ideas, solutions, or services from a wide range of individuals or organizations to address specific needs or issues.
What information must be reported on call for proposals?
A call for proposals typically includes information on the project scope, objectives, eligibility criteria, submission deadlines, evaluation criteria, budget details, and contact information.
